Family Ministry Pastor – Full-Time Position

General Statement

First Baptist Church, Clover is prayerfully seeking an experienced Family Ministry Pastor. This is a full-time position. Clover, SC is a rapidly growing community. Although Clover still has a small-town feel, it has a growth rate of +16%. Clover school district is one of the finest in the State. Currently, the District is adding a new High school, Middle school and Elementary school to meet the demand of over 3000 new homes currently permitted in Clover.

First Baptist Church, Clover is growing along with the town. We consistently exceed 400 attendees in two services on Sundays. Our growth is mostly with young families with children. We have a thriving Awana and Youth program on Wednesday nights. Upward Sports has been a great contributor to that growth.

We believe the Family Ministry Pastor should be a person called of God, led by the Holy Spirit, adequately trained, and called by the church to supervise, prepare, and support the outreach and mission of the church. He must work as a team member with other church staff and lay leaders.

Qualifications
  • The Pastor of Family Ministries must be called by God for ministry.
  • He will have a growing relationship with Jesus Christ and regularly attend worship services.
  • He will be an effective communicator of Christ-centered discipleship, will teach the Word rightly, be able to communicate the gospel clearly, and joyfully encourage others to do the same.
  • He will have a degree from an accredited Theological Seminary, or equivalent experience working with youth, children, or similar ministries.
  • He will have a knowledge of Scripture and Biblical principles, with the ability to communicate these principles in a relatable way to children, youth, and parents.
  • He will be available to lead and support scheduled children and youth ministry activities during regular church meeting hours, as well as after hours as warranted.
  • He will be passionate about building up and supporting families.
  • He will have strong administrative and delegation skills.
